wondering what is the best product in making these bbs ck ball bearing finish shine after a wash and drying the car
or is it best just to wipe them down
(https://www.mk5golfgti.co.uk/forum/proxy.php?request=http%3A%2F%2Fdaz.co%2Fmedia%2Fcc20%2Fmaxitrol%2FIMG_0203.jpg&hash=f9c99ec0b9cbca19f7f06cb0c7248e5411fb6b60)
-
Best bet is some fk1000p sealant. You should find that you won't need anything over shampoo and a wash mitt and rinse to keepnthem tip top. If you find you need a little more cleaning power, Then use some weak bilberry wheel cleaner on them as part of a wash procedure. :stupid:
